Type
ORACLE
Validation date
2025-05-13 08: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.0252e-4,
    "usd": 1.139e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FD5C0037D43057113D2164436B0B3A243650AC02A771BCD381F9818E779C0C67

Previous signature

0AD641C279268154366823A0B058A7353FA59364484EF135A099C3B171E3C94B83828EF85A81DF9F3F13DCE36DF6B53BBB77F0F135CCEC2CEA0CDC1C9342400B

Origin signature

304502202B718D4AFAF5CC1DA0BA064A2EAF9A758D1C00F8ABD7F32FC17B188366935757022100A2D30E7789C21C7768E417E8B9CF8871730C8430A243C848DE870A0F0B4FB5FA

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

002C92E14DD02355B8A8A664D8FEA5AAAF0147657C50B4F79B3655CA10F71B79C1

Coordinator signature

2C53736EBDC068831F76F776B99D8D4420644853073DF27EA11BA1AE2511B00B42F2936C319D48F5CE29276CD95FC0ECB0E21E61979EB7420F5193948756AC0C

Validator #1 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#1 signature

F7B23A7922BA0EA7B1E6E43C89BCA4DBF5DD250C8C01C4A02B6D2BBE59FD1B9352DBE4843FB09532FD89CF93AED97D4BB480D9FAFA49CBE9ECCFC89243CF3905

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

E281A3BF1107ECEF5EC0919026DF3A31C74D8324A158C30E633ED7F312B02F9420AC268B6F7379EF4F0910F805BA6EE8C4EF844E344D277B04AF19DD68182D0F